Navi Mumbai, April 2: Two men were arrested for allegedly trafficking MD (mephedrone) in Koparkhairane, with police seizing contraband worth Rs 11.60 lakh, officials said.

The accused, identified as Mohammad Faiz Ali Khan (24) and Altaf Munna Sheikh (25), were produced in court and remanded to police custody till April 2.

Drugs seized during early morning patrol

The Anti-Narcotics Task Force of the Konkan Division carried out the action in the early hours of March 29 while patrolling near Sector 9. The duo was intercepted on suspicion while heading towards the railway station, and a search led to the recovery of 58 grams of MD powder.

Case registered under NDPS Act

Police have registered a case under the NDPS Act at Koparkhairane Police Station. In addition to the drugs, two mobile phones were seized, taking the total value of the recovered material to around Rs 12 lakh.

Business used as alleged front for trafficking

Investigations revealed that Khan was allegedly using his water can distribution business as a front for drug trafficking. He had previously been booked under the NDPS Act in Mumbai’s Trombay area around six to seven months ago.

“Two persons have been arrested and a significant quantity of MD has been seized. Further investigation is underway to trace the supply network,” a police officer said.

Accused linked through past criminal cases

According to police, both accused are known to each other and have prior involvement in separate murder cases. They reportedly became friends while in jail, and Sheikh would source drugs from Khan to supply to buyers.
